# Tvardi Therapeutics | 8-K: FY2026 Q2 Revenue: USD 0

Revenue: As of FY2026 Q2, the actual value is USD 0.

EPS: As of FY2026 Q2, the actual value is USD -0.69, missing the estimate of USD -0.625.

EBIT: As of FY2026 Q2, the actual value is USD -6.457 M.

### Operating Expenses

-   **Research and development expenses** for the three months ended June 30, 2026, were $4.0 million, a decrease from $5.8 million for the comparable period in 2025. For the six months ended June 30, 2026, these expenses were $8.913 million, compared to $8.917 million for the same period in 2025.
-   **General and administrative expenses** were $2.6 million for the three months ended June 30, 2026, a decrease from $3.1 million for the three months ended June 30, 2025. For the six months ended June 30, 2026, these expenses were $4.767 million, an increase from $4.306 million for the same period in 2025.
-   **Total operating expenses** for the three months ended June 30, 2026, were $6.629 million, down from $8.869 million in the comparable 2025 period. For the six months ended June 30, 2026, total operating expenses were $13.680 million, an increase from $13.223 million for the same period in 2025.

### Net (Loss) Income

-   **Loss from operations** for the three months ended June 30, 2026, was - $6.629 million, an improvement from - $8.869 million in the comparable 2025 period. For the six months ended June 30, 2026, loss from operations was - $13.680 million, compared to - $13.223 million for the same period in 2025.
-   **Interest income** was $0.172 million for the three months ended June 30, 2026, compared to $0.377 million in the comparable 2025 period. For the six months ended June 30, 2026, interest income was $0.419 million, compared to $0.652 million for the same period in 2025.
-   **Other income, net** was $0 million for the three months ended June 30, 2026, compared to $12.659 million in the comparable 2025 period. For the six months ended June 30, 2026, other income, net was $0 million, compared to $7.159 million for the same period in 2025.
-   **Net loss** for the three months ended June 30, 2026, was - $6.457 million, compared to a net income of $4.167 million for the three months ended June 30, 2025. For the six months ended June 30, 2026, net loss was - $13.261 million, compared to - $5.412 million for the same period in 2025.

### Cash Position

-   **Cash, cash equivalents and short-term investments** were $15.8 million as of June 30, 2026, a decrease from $30.8 million as of December 31, 2025.

### Balance Sheet (in thousands)

-   **Total current assets** as of June 30, 2026, were $17,069, down from $31,538 as of December 31, 2025.
-   **Total assets** as of June 30, 2026, were $17,517, compared to $32,073 as of December 31, 2025.
-   **Total current liabilities** as of June 30, 2026, were $9,113, compared to $11,042 as of December 31, 2025.
-   **Total liabilities** as of June 30, 2026, were $9,135, compared to $11,127 as of December 31, 2025.
-   **Total stockholders’ equity** as of June 30, 2026, was $8,382, compared to $20,946 as of December 31, 2025.

### Operational Metrics and Developments

-   Tvardi Therapeutics, Inc. reported topline results from the healthy volunteer study of its next-generation STAT3 inhibitor, TTI-109, confirming its prodrug design, improved tolerability, and pharmacodynamic evidence of STAT3 target engagement.
-   TTI-109 delivered TTI-101-equivalent exposure with improved tolerability and reductions in cellular and humoral immune populations.
-   Ulcerative Colitis (UC) has been selected as the initial disease indication for TTI-109, representing a large, underserved market with over 1.25 million patients diagnosed in the U.S. and an addressable market of approximately $3 billion in the U.S. and $9 billion globally.

### Outlook and Guidance

-   Tvardi Therapeutics, Inc. anticipates its existing cash, cash equivalents, and short-term investments will fund operations through the TTI-101 HCC topline readout into the third quarter of 2027.
-   Key upcoming milestones include a KOL webinar on August 19, 2026, and topline data for TTI-101 Phase 1b/2 HCC in Q4 2026.
-   The initiation of a clinical trial for TTI-109 in UC is planned for 2027, subject to Investigational New Drug (IND) application clearance and additional funding.
